RAY COUNTY TRANSPORTATION INC, founded in 1985, is a community nonprofit that reported $1.9M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. The organization ran a surplus of $444K, a strong 24% operating margin.

Mission

TO OFFER SAFE, RELIABLE, AFFORDABLE AND DIVERSIFIED TRANSPORTATION SERVICES TO THE CITIZENS OF RAY COUNTY, AND TO DO OUR PART TO ENHANCE THE QUALITY OF LIFE FOR THOSE WE SERVE.
